Design, fabrication, and test of a 5.5X telescope to retrofit an existing FLIR system

The design considerations and approach to developing a 5.5X afocal telescope to retrofit an existing prototype FLIR system that did not anticipate the inclusion of a telescope are presented. Besides having to meet certain mechanical limitations, the afocal telescope was designed to correct for residual aberrations in the FLIR optics rather than being more generic in nature. The optical performance of the FLIR with and without the afocal telescope are compared. Fabrication issues and test results are presented.
